Job description

Job Requirements

This Senior Director - Operations role is responsible for planning, directing, and overseeing operations within the assigned region/offices to ensure efficient, cost-effective systems that support current and future business needs. The position involves defining and implementing operational strategies, staying informed on industry trends, and ensuring project delivery meets financial goals. Key responsibilities include managing day-to-day operations, monitoring budgets and financial performance, driving process improvements, ensuring compliance, and collaborating with sales, IT, HR, Finance, and collections teams to optimize resources and maintain positive cash flow. Additionally, the role leads talent management efforts, including recruitment, development, succession planning, and fostering a high-performance culture aligned with company values, while providing coaching and mentorship to enhance professional growth and operational excellence.


Compensation

The expected pay range for this position is $136,172 - $181,562 annually, depending on experience, qualifications, and geographic location.


Stark Tech reasonably expects to pay within this range at the time of hire. Individual compensation is determined based on several factors including experience, education, certifications, skills, internal equity, and market conditions.


Work Experience
  •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Operations Management, or other related field required. Master's degree preferred. 
  • At least 15 years of industry-related experience required.
  • At least 5 years of proven experience in a senior operational management role, ideally within the construction industry, required. 
  • Demonstrated working knowledge of controls theories and contracting best practices. 
  • Knowledge of legacy customers' installed base systems or other building automation software preferred.
  • Expert knowledge of CAD software and MS Office suite, preferred.
  • Strong leadership qualities with the ability to motivate and inspire a diverse team. 
  • Exceptional commun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to interact effectively at all levels of the organization. 
  • Ability to adapt and be flexible in a changing environment.
  • Ability to multi-task, work under pressure and meet deadlines required.
  • Must be able to deal with a large volume of work in a fast-paced, time-sensitive environment.
